Transaction 500e0b70f79bc80566e604106dacdf199bff5e895f76d8e5c4f54124ff540dbc

1 Input
1 Outputs
  • 500e0b70f79bc80566e604106dacdf199bff5e895f76d8e5c4f54124ff540dbc:0
  • value  2079841
    address  32KyYgphG8MtUCTTQtHEHjB7TRMTLKHErR